Thanks to contributor #47466150 Grand Island (Nebraska) Daily Independent Friday, 13 April 1951 Fullerton, Neb., April 13 - Lawrence Prososki, 33, lifelong Nance County resident and World War II veteran, died of a heart attack Sunday as he was crossing a field on the Pete Vetick home southeast of Fullerton near Silver Creek. He was on his way to get a tractor to pull out his car, which had mired down on a muddy road, when he was stricken. He is survived by his parents; nine brothers, Mike and Wallace of Genoa, Louis and John Jr., of Fullerton, Charles of Silver Creek, Joseph of Osceola, Rudolph, Clemens and David at home, and three sisters, Mrs. Pete Vetick of Silver Creek, Mrs. Pete Borowiak and Mrs. Joseph Cuba of Genoa. Funeral services were held Wednesday at the Sts. Peter and Paul Catholic church, with the Rev. Edward Saliwoski officiating. Burial was in the Fullerton Cemetery.
